Bathroom Water Damage Restoration Cost in Enon, OH
The cost of bathroom water damage restoration in Enon, OH can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will work with you to provide a free estimate and ensure that you understand the costs involved.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Contamination and assessment |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water extraction and dr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| Amount of water extracted, drying time |
| Repair and replacement | $2,000 – $10,000 | Extent of damage, materials needed for repair |
| Moisture detection and measurement |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Equipment rental and usage | $1,000 – $5,000 | Amount of equipment used, rental fees |
| Permits and inspections |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age, local regulations |
